Car collision repair is a specialized process designed to restore damaged vehicles to their pre-accident condition, ensuring they meet safety standards. When a car is involved in a collision, various components can be affected, from structural integrity to cosmetic elements. Skilled technicians employ advanced techniques and replacement parts to fix these issues, making the vehicle safe and roadworthy again.

The process involves several steps, including assessing the damage, disassembling affected parts, repairing or replacing them, and then reassembling the vehicle while ensuring all safety features function correctly. Once the repair is complete, a roadworthiness certification is required to verify that the car meets legal standards for safe operation on public roads, thus giving owners peace of mind and ensuring compliance with regulations.
